Source: describe_todo.cs
...131 [Category("RunningSpecs")]132 [Category("Pending")]133 public class using_todo : describe_todo134 {135 class TodoClass : nspec136 {137 void method_level_context()138 {139 it["should be pending"] = todo;140 }141 }142 [Test]143 public void example_should_be_pending()144 {145 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(TodoClass));146 example.HasRun.Should().BeTrue();147 example.Pending.Should().BeTrue();148 }149 }150 [TestFixture]151 [Category("RunningSpecs")]152 [Category("Pending")]153 [Category("Async")]154 public class using_async_todo : describe_todo155 {156 class AsyncTodoClass : nspec157 {158 void method_level_context()159 {160 itAsync["should be pending"] = todoAsync;161 }162 }163 [Test]164 public void example_should_be_pending()165 {166 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(AsyncTodoClass));167 example.HasRun.Should().BeTrue();168 example.Pending.Should().BeTrue();169 }170 }171 [TestFixture]172 [Category("RunningSpecs")]173 [Category("Pending")]174 public class using_todo_with_throwing_before_all : describe_todo175 {176 class TodoClass : nspec177 {178 void method_level_context()179 {180 beforeAll = () => { throw new KnownException(); };181 it["should be pending"] = todo;182 }183 }184 [Test]185 public void example_should_be_pending()186 {187 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(TodoClass));188 example.HasRun.Should().BeTrue();189 example.Pending.Should().BeTrue();190 }191 [Test]192 public void example_should_not_throw()193 {194 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(TodoClass));195 example.Exception.Should().BeNull();196 }197 }198 [TestFixture]199 [Category("RunningSpecs")]200 [Category("Pending")]201 public class using_todo_with_throwing_before : describe_todo202 {203 class TodoClass : nspec204 {205 void method_level_context()206 {207 before = () => { throw new KnownException(); };208 it["should be pending"] = todo;209 }210 }211 [Test]212 public void example_should_be_pending()213 {214 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(TodoClass));215 example.HasRun.Should().BeTrue();216 example.Pending.Should().BeTrue();217 }218 [Test]219 public void example_should_not_throw()220 {221 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(TodoClass));222 example.Exception.Should().BeNull();223 }224 }225 [TestFixture]226 [Category("RunningSpecs")]227 [Category("Pending")]228 public class using_todo_with_throwing_act : describe_todo229 {230 class TodoClass : nspec231 {232 void method_level_context()233 {234 act = () => { throw new KnownException(); };235 it["should be pending"] = todo;236 }237 }238 [Test]239 public void example_should_be_pending()240 {241 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(TodoClass));242 example.HasRun.Should().BeTrue();243 example.Pending.Should().BeTrue();244 }245 [Test]246 public void example_should_not_throw()247 {248 var example = ExampleFrom(typeof(TodoClass));249 example.Exception.Should().BeNull();250 }251 }252 public class describe_todo : when_running_specs253 {254 protected ExampleBase ExampleFrom(Type type)255 {256 Run(type);257 return classContext.AllExamples().First();258 }259 }260}...
